We all want to be an ally for people with disability. But we don’t always know how. By listening to people with disability, this ten-part series gives insiders’ perspectives and advice to allies on how to “tool up” and make the world a richer and better place through supporting inclusion.

    Episode 3: Why identity matters

    Episode 3: Why identity matters

    We look at how the words we use to discuss disability drive how we see things and the differences between person-first and identity-first language, and between “ill-health”, “impairment” and disability.
